Oh god, that's a thoughtful game. The way that there aren't many damage dealing hydra head but more defensive ones, requires us to think about placements carefully.

Furthermore, the fact that enemies move and attack first before the hydra heads can attack means that we need to plan even more ahead. If we don't have defensive cards to go along with the attacker hydras when an enemy is about to attack, we aren't pretty much dead as they die before they can attack.

We need to be clever on each turn :smile: . Reminds me a lot of the game "Into the Breach" where enemies next move is being shown !

I managed to get to wave 4, when the Spikehead stopped working for some reason.

The game has tightly fitting graphics for its style.

I think that the music chosen didn't really fit the mood of the game. It felt too lighthearted and distracting. It could have been a melody with a more strategic feel, with focus on harder, lower pitched percussion and rolling drums, rather than the distracting and offputting alternation between the piccolo/flute and the plucked string. The beginning of the song starts more or less well but then the drums start receding into the distance and the castanets overshadow them, and the focus starts devolving to the alternation between the plucked string and piccolo/flute parts. The cello part is cool, though.

In terms of gameplay, I think that there is a lack of Headachers in the early waves, making the difficulty curve a bit steep. Having an extra Headacher in the early waves would be nice.

Very polished entry with all the tutorial and overall smooth controls and cohesive graphics.

I feel the cards semi-covering the heads is a bit awkward, could just let the player see the heads and let the placement interaction happen on those. Because the cards contain the health and the info but the placement relative to the grid is very important and there is a bit of disconnect there with the cards' size and location. Maybe if the grid cells were as wide as the cards, it would work better?
